Structural Response of Shaped Concrete Units Subjected to Blast Loading: A Parametric Study,nit are higher by 390% than the corresponding values for the apsidal unit. The apsidal unit performs better in resisting the explosive loads considered in the study, indicating a better response towards blast resistance.

Cross-Section Based Performance Assessment of Buckling Restrained Braces,e element analysis. Maximum energy dissipation was recorded for a rectangular core cross-section along the yield length with cruciform end parts and hollow circular BRBs. Additionally, all-steel BRBs behaved more hysterically than those BRBs loaded with concrete.

Numerical Study on Ballistic Resistance of Whipple Shield Under Different Ellipsoid Projectiles Aga.46 under high-velocity impact. However, in hypervelocity impact, the ballistic resistance of the Whipple shield decreases with an increase in SF. It is also observed that the residual velocity is minimum for SF?=?0.28 for hypervelocity impact.
